# Helix
-| Crate | Description |
-| ----------- | ----------- |
-| helix-core | Core editing primitives, functional. |
-| helix-syntax | Tree-sitter grammars |
-| helix-view | UI abstractions for use in backends, imperative shell. |
-| helix-term | Terminal UI |
+A kakoune / neovim inspired editor, written in Rust.
+
+The editing model is very heavily based on kakoune; during development I found
+myself agreeing with most of kakoune's design decisions.
+
+# Features
+
+- Vim-like modal editing
+- Multiple selections
+- Built-in language server support
+- Smart, incremental syntax highlighting and code editing via tree-sitter
+
+It's a terminal-based editor first, but I'd like to explore a custom renderer
+(similar to emacs) in wgpu or skulpin.
# Installation
+We provide packaging for various distributions, but here's a quick method to
+build from source.
+
```
-git clone --depth 1 --recurse-submodules -j8 https://github.com/helix-editor/helix
+git clone --recurse-submodules --shallow-submodules -j8 https://github.com/helix-editor/helix
cd helix
cargo install --path helix-term
```
This will install the `hx` binary to `$HOME/.cargo/bin`.
+Now copy the `runtime/` directory somewhere. Helix will by default look for the
+runtime inside the same folder as the executable, but that can be overriden via
+the `HELIX_RUNTIME` environment variable.
